the hotel is suitable for those tourists who do not intend to stay in it for days, as demanding and self-respecting people will be dissatisfied: old furniture, cockroaches, leaking showers, locks that are easy to break with a nail file. Tip: carry valuables with you, or hide them in places where they simply won’t think of looking for them.
the sea is a nightmare, the shallows are just terribly long, until you get to the depths, you will not want to swim. the beach is small and when a new group settles, the struggle for beach towels begins - they are always gone. personally, I had to spend more than half an hour at the reception, before I managed to achieve something.
the food is good, the food is tasty and you can eat as much as you like. meat, side dishes, fruits, even soups : )))
demand to be settled on the 2nd floor!!!

do not fall for the tricks of the staff - you can smile sweetly, but do not let them do it too much. the only normal person is Mohammed, Steven is 50/50, still that crook. the less you communicate with him - the calmer your nervous system.
when problems arise - do not put them off indefinitely, but immediately demand their solution. do not be shy. the more politely you ask, the more likely it is that your request will not be fulfilled.
you can freely travel to the city - minibus 1 pound, taxi - 10 pounds. taxi drivers call a big price, but it's just a banal scam.
